This vision is closer to reality than you might think, thanks to the efforts recognized by the seventh annual Smart Cities North America Awards (SCNAA). Hosted by IDC Government Insights, the awards spotlight the strides North American cities, states, counties, and universities are making towards becoming smarter, more sustainable, and more inclusive communities.
Spotlight on Innovation and Inclusivity
The SCNAA finalists, a diverse group of 42 municipalities and educational institutions, are at the forefront of employing technology to enhance every facet of urban life. These projects span 14 categories, including Administration and Civic Engagement, Digital Equity, Public Health, Smart Buildings, and Sustainable Infrastructure. Each category underscores a unique aspect of smart city development, from improving government operations and engaging citizens to ensuring equitable access to digital resources and fostering healthier, more resilient communities.

A Step Towards the Future
The winners of the SCNAA will be announced on March 27th and celebrated at the Smart Cities Connect conference in Raleigh, NC, from May 7-10. This event is not just an awards ceremony but a gathering of minds dedicated to pushing the boundaries of what's possible in urban development. It's a chance for cities, states, counties, and universities to share insights, forge partnerships, and inspire others to embark on their smart city journeys.
